PROBLEM TO BE SOLVED: To provide an operational amplifier, capable of obtaining a large output current by a low power supply voltage VDD and a small pattern area. SOLUTION: The voltage of the difference of input signals VI1 and VI2 supplied to input terminals 1 and 2 are amplified in a differential input part 10, and signals V1 are outputted from a node N1 to an amplifying part 20 and an output part 30. Since the amplifying part 20 is driven by a boosted voltage VCP generated in a boosting part 50, the signals V2 outputted from the node N2 to the output part 30 become higher than the power supply voltage VDD. Thus, the voltage between the gate and source of the NMOSes 31 and 32 of the output part 30 becomes large and the large output current is made to flow, even when a gate width is narrow.
